Mabon Hot Apple Cider
Jules NakonecznyjA Cup Full of Autumn Magic
If there is one drink that captures the essence of Mabon, it’s hot apple cider. The scent alone — warm apple, cinnamon, clove, and citrus — is enough to shift the energy of a room and call in the spirit of the autumn equinox. This version is sweetened with real maple syrup and infused with a bundle of whole spices, making it as intentional as it is delicious.
Make a big pot and share it. This is a drink meant for gathering.
Ingredients & Their Magic
- 6 cups apple cider — love, healing, wisdom, immortality, connection to the Goddess and the harvest
- ¼ cup real maple syrup — abundance, sweetness, prosperity, drawing in good things
- 2 cinnamon sticks — prosperity, success, love, psychic awareness, raising vibration, warmth
- 6 whole cloves — protection, banishing negativity, love, money, stopping gossip
- 6 whole allspice berries — luck, healing, money, determination, energy
- 1 orange peel, cut into strips — joy, abundance, prosperity, solar energy, good luck
- 1 lemon peel, cut into strips — cleansing, purification, love, uplifting energy, clarity
Method
- Pour the apple cider and maple syrup into a large pot. Stir gently to combine — as you do, set your intention for the drink. What are you calling in this Mabon season?
- Gather your whole spices and citrus peels and bundle them into a square of cheesecloth. Tie it closed with kitchen string. This is your spice sachet — think of it like a tea bag, or a little charm bag for your cider. Hold it in your hands for a moment and breathe your intention into it before dropping it into the pot.
- Place the pot over medium heat. Let it warm slowly for 5–10 minutes until the cider is steaming and fragrant. Don’t let it boil — you want it hot and inviting, not agitated.
- Once it’s beautifully hot and your kitchen smells like autumn itself, remove from heat. Fish out and discard the spice bundle — it’s done its work.
- Ladle into mugs and tuck a fresh cinnamon stick into each one if you like. Serve immediately, while it’s steaming.
Ritual Notes
This cider is wonderful served during the cakes and ale portion of a Mabon ritual, or simply passed around a fire circle as an act of community and warmth. As you hand each person their mug, you might say: “May this cup bring you warmth, abundance, and gratitude.”
